You can offer small amounts of fruit and vegetables (such as: apples,
bananas, peas, broccoli, sprouts and carrots). Cooked egg, cooked
chicken and cooked pasta are also fine to give.
If she is being a good mother you should not have to do anything to feed the pups. By about 3 weeks of age they are fully developed and will start eating solid food, though they are still being fed by their mother for about another week.
Remember, after 4 to 4.5 weeks, the males should be separated from the rest of the pups and mom since they could impregnate their mother.
